What is CVE-2018-3181?
The Oracle Hospitality Cruise Shipboard Property Management System contains a vulnerability that can be exploited by a low privileged attacker who is logged into the network where the system operates. This flaw grants the attacker the ability to access sensitive information and potentially gain complete control over the data managed by this system. As such, it raises significant concerns regarding the confidentiality of critical data stored within the Oracle Hospitality ecosystem.
